A young student who died after jumping into the Turag river while being chased by a crowd after setting a fire on bus in Dhaka's Mirpur was allegedly lured with Tk 5,000 for the arson attack, police said.
The incident took place around 10:10pm near the Mirpur Zoo area along the Beribadh road beside the Turag river, where the bus was parked.
The deceased was identified as Abdullah Al Sayad, 18, a second-year college student.
His friend, Rudro Mohammad Amir Sani, 18, an O-level student, was caught by locals and handed over to police.
Police also said a third youth, aged 18-19, was also involved in the incident, without providing details.
Assistant Commissioner Emdad Hossain of DMP (Darus Salam zone) told The Daily Star that the three were promised money to set the bus on fire.
"Interrogation of the arrestee revealed that a local Awami League leader promised them Tk 5,000 to set fire to a vehicle anywhere within the Dhaka-14 constituency," he said.
A case has been filed naming Amir Sani in connection with the incident, the AC added.
According to police and witnesses, on Thursday night, a Kiranmala Paribahan bus parked at the Mirpur Beribadh area was set on fire.
Locals chased the youths, catching Amir Sani, while Abdullah fled by jumping into the Turag river. His body was later recovered around 10:30pm.
The post-mortem examination of Abdullah was conducted at Shaheed Suhrawardy Medical College.
Hospital sources said his family from Uttara collected the body today.
